Akwa Ibom Governor Umo Eno defects to APC

Governor Umo Eno of Akwa Ibom State has defected from the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) to the All Progressives Congress (APC).
The governor made the announcement at a press conference in Uyo, the state capital, citing his desire to fully support President Bola Tinubu’s economic reforms.
”Having completed the rounds of my consultations as your servant, I have therefore decided to progressivesly moved to the All Progressives Congress (APC).
“We are not joining the APC from a position of weakness, we are joining the APC from a position of strength,” he said.
Eno emphasised that he was joining the APC from a position of strength, rather than weakness.
He said that his decision was motivated by the need to align the state with the federal government and attract more development projects.
The governor expressed his admiration for President Tinubu’s leadership and economic reforms, which he believed would benefit the state and its people.
He also pledged to support the president’s re-election bid.
The defection is seen as a significant boost to the APC’s fortunes in the state.
The party is expected to leverage the governor’s influence to strengthen its presence in the state and advance its agenda.
